54// Index maps names registered by IANA to Encodings.
55// Currently different Indexes only differ in the names they return for
56// encodings. In the future they may also differ in supported aliases.
57type Index struct {
58	names func(i int) string
59	toMIB []identifier.MIB // Sorted slice of supported MIBs
60	alias map[string]int
61	enc   []encoding.Encoding
62}
63
64var (
65	errInvalidName = errors.New("ianaindex: invalid encoding name")
66	errUnknown     = errors.New("ianaindex: unknown Encoding")
67	errUnsupported = errors.New("ianaindex: unsupported Encoding")
68)
69
70// Encoding returns an Encoding for IANA-registered names. Matching is
71// case-insensitive.
72func (x *Index) Encoding(name string) (encoding.Encoding, error) {
73	name = strings.TrimSpace(name)
74	// First try without lowercasing (possibly creating an allocation).
75	i, ok := x.alias[name]
76	if !ok {
77		i, ok = x.alias[strings.ToLower(name)]
78		if !ok {
79			return nil, errInvalidName
80		}
81	}
82	return x.enc[i], nil
83}
84
85// Name reports the canonical name of the given Encoding. It will return an
86// error if the e is not associated with a known encoding scheme.
87func (x *Index) Name(e encoding.Encoding) (string, error) {
88	id, ok := e.(identifier.Interface)
89	if !ok {
90		return "", errUnknown
91	}
92	mib, _ := id.ID()
93	if mib == 0 {
94		return "", errUnknown
95	}
96	v := findMIB(x.toMIB, mib)
97	if v == -1 {
98		return "", errUnsupported
99	}
100	return x.names(v), nil
101}
